Car Air Freshener Market Size
The global car air freshener market was valued at USD 872.56 million in 2024 and is projected to reach USD 897.9 million in 2025, growing to USD 1,128.6 million by 2033, with a CAGR of 2.9% during the forecast period from 2025 to 2033.
The U.S. car air freshener market is expected to grow steadily, driven by rising consumer preferences for improved in-car experiences, increasing vehicle ownership, and demand for innovative, long-lasting fragrances during the forecast period 2025-2033.

Car Air Freshener Market Trends
The car air freshener market is shifting towards natural and organic products, with 40% of consumers preferring air fresheners made from plant-based ingredients. Eco-conscious packaging solutions are also gaining traction, with 35% of customers favoring sustainable materials such as biodegradable plastics and recyclable containers.
Technological advancements have led to 15% of new product launches featuring smart air fresheners that can be controlled via mobile apps, offering users flexibility in scent intensity and duration. Among product types, vent clips dominate the market, accounting for 30% of total sales, due to their ease of use and long-lasting fragrance.
Customization is another key trend, with 25% of consumers seeking personalized scent combinations. Luxury and premium fragrances are gaining popularity, with 20% of buyers willing to spend more on high-end air fresheners.
The rising number of ride-sharing services has also boosted demand, as 25% of professional drivers use air fresheners to enhance passenger experience. Seasonal and limited-edition scents, especially during holidays, contribute to 18% of total annual sales. These trends highlight the evolving preferences of consumers and the market’s continuous innovation in fragrance technology.

Market Restraints
Growing concerns over synthetic chemicals and volatile organic compounds (VOCs) have led 40% of consumers to seek alternatives to traditional air fresheners. 30% of consumers report allergies or sensitivities to artificial fragrances, limiting product adoption in certain demographics.
Environmental regulations are also impacting the market, with 20% of manufacturers reformulating products to comply with stricter guidelines. The shift towards biodegradable and eco-friendly options increases production costs, reducing profit margins for companies. Additionally, the preference for natural essential oil-based fresheners has risen by 45%, further impacting the demand for chemical-based alternatives.
Market Challenges
The car air freshener market is highly competitive, with over 200 brands offering similar products. Price sensitivity remains a major challenge, as 30% of consumers switch brands frequently based on promotions and discounts.
Private-label brands and low-cost alternatives are capturing 20% of market sales, making it difficult for premium brands to maintain profitability. The fluctuating cost of raw materials has increased production expenses by 12%, impacting pricing strategies. Additionally, brand loyalty remains low, with only 25% of consumers repurchasing the same brand consistently, forcing companies to focus on aggressive marketing strategies to retain customers.

By Type
-
Electric Air Fresheners: Electric air fresheners are gaining popularity, accounting for 30% of total market sales due to their consistent and long-lasting fragrance output. These fresheners use heat or fan-based diffusion systems, ensuring even scent distribution throughout the vehicle. 40% of consumers prefer electric air fresheners for their automated fragrance control features. Additionally, 25% of newly launched air fresheners include rechargeable or plug-in electric models, appealing to tech-savvy users. Their growing integration with smart technology, such as Bluetooth-enabled scent control, is also increasing their demand among premium vehicle owners, particularly in luxury and high-end car segments.
-
Evaporative Air Fresheners: Evaporative air fresheners dominate the market with a 45% share, attributed to their affordability and ease of use. These fresheners utilize porous materials or gels to release fragrances gradually, making them a popular choice among budget-conscious consumers. 50% of car owners prefer evaporative fresheners due to their ability to function without electricity or batteries. Additionally, 35% of ride-share drivers use evaporative fresheners for consistent odor control in their vehicles. The demand for eco-friendly variants has also surged, with 20% of newly launched evaporative fresheners featuring biodegradable or recyclable materials.
-
Spray Air Fresheners: Spray air fresheners hold a 25% market share and remain a preferred choice for instant odor elimination. These fresheners are valued for their convenience, with 55% of consumers using them for immediate freshness before trips or after carrying pets or food in the car. Their affordability and wide range of scent options make them a frequent purchase, with 40% of buyers purchasing sprays monthly. However, concerns over aerosol-based formulations have led 30% of consumers to seek water-based alternatives. The introduction of antibacterial and odor-neutralizing sprays is driving further adoption in commercial fleets and taxi services.

Regional Outlook
The car air freshener market exhibits diverse growth patterns across various regions, influenced by factors such as consumer preferences, economic conditions, and vehicle ownership rates. Key regions analyzed include North America, Europe, Asia-Pacific, and the Middle East & Africa.
North America
North America holds a significant share of the car air freshener market, driven by high vehicle ownership rates and a strong consumer preference for in-car fragrances. In 2023, the market was valued at approximately US$ 973.3 million, with the United States accounting for around 70% of this value. The popularity of hanging car air fresheners is notable, capturing a substantial portion of the market. Leading companies such as S.C. Johnson & Son Inc. and The Procter & Gamble Company have a prominent presence in this region, offering a wide range of products to cater to diverse consumer preferences.
Europe
Europe represents a substantial portion of the car air freshener market, with countries like Germany, France, and the United Kingdom leading in consumption. The region's emphasis on environmental sustainability has led to a growing demand for eco-friendly and natural air fresheners. Approximately 35% of European consumers prefer products with organic ingredients and recyclable packaging. The presence of major automotive industries in this region also contributes to the steady demand for car air fresheners, as consumers seek to enhance their driving experience with pleasant fragrances.
Asia-Pacific
The Asia-Pacific region is experiencing rapid growth in the car air freshener market, propelled by increasing vehicle ownership and rising disposable incomes in countries such as China, India, and Japan. The market is projected to expand significantly, with a notable increase in demand for affordable and long-lasting air fresheners. Consumers in this region show a preference for innovative products, including gel-based and vent-clip air fresheners, which offer convenience and durability. Local manufacturers are also introducing a variety of fragrances tailored to regional preferences, further driving market growth.
Middle East & Africa
The Middle East & Africa region is gradually embracing car air fresheners, with a growing awareness of in-car air quality and an increasing number of vehicles on the road. The market is witnessing a steady rise in demand, particularly in urban centers where consumers are adopting air fresheners to enhance their driving experience. Products with strong and long-lasting fragrances are favored, catering to regional preferences. International brands are expanding their presence in this region, often collaborating with local distributors to reach a broader customer base.
